DIXON v. DORNEY


588 A.2d 322 (1991)

Alphonso A. DIXON, Sr., et al., v. Ann DORNEY.

Supreme Judicial Court of Maine.

Decided April 2, 1991.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Louis J. Shiro (orally) Shiro & Shiro, Waterville, for plaintiffs.

Phillip E. Johnson (orally), Kristin A. Gustafson, Pierce, Atwood, Scribner, Allen, Smith & Lancaster, Augusta, for defendant.

Before ROBERTS, WATHEN, GLASSMAN, COLLINS and BRODY, JJ.


PER CURIAM.

Plaintiffs Alphonso A. Dixon, Sr., and Beverly J. Dixon appeal from an adverse judgment entered after a jury trial in the Superior Court (Somerset County, Browne, J.) on their complaint alleging that a medical misdiagnosis caused the closing of their convenience store.
